About Tier 11
Tier 11 specialize in building, managing and optimizing large scale Facebook ad and Instagram ad campaigns at a positive return on ad spend for the e-commerce and information marketing industries. The company was established in 2010 and is headquartered in Sagamore Beach, Massachusetts.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Barnstable?

Understanding the cost of living near Barnstable is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Tier 11.
Barnstable (incl. Hyannis) Cost of Living Index is approximately 130.2 (30.2% more expensive than US average; 1.9% less than MA average). Cape Cod's largest town, high housing costs, tourism driven.
